Transaction 3132fc71ca33e32731b19f8631bd3155ddfdb9fcfd90e5dbe89f401a93c9744f

3 Input
2 Outputs
  • 3132fc71ca33e32731b19f8631bd3155ddfdb9fcfd90e5dbe89f401a93c9744f:0
  • value  19000000
    address  1K6VkqoKofR1yG66rc64sse9EqAickpEyr
  • 3132fc71ca33e32731b19f8631bd3155ddfdb9fcfd90e5dbe89f401a93c9744f:1
  • value  185743
    address  1PdCQFKE2N2gFxECRP7d7v1SK4xhw9uKE6